Understanding Semaglutide: The Future of Weight and Diabetes Management

Semaglutide is a synthetic form of a naturally occurring hormone that helps regulate blood sugar levels, suppresses appetite, and promotes weight loss. Its approval by leading health authorities for both type 2 diabetes and obesity treatment underscores its importance. When administered correctly, Semaglutide delivers powerful health benefits, including improved glycemic control and sustained weight reduction.

Administering Semaglutide: Best Practices for Safe Injection

1. Choosing the Injection Site

Semaglutide is administered subcutaneously, usually in areas like the abdomen, thigh, or upper arm. Rotate sites regularly to prevent tissue irritation and ensure consistent absorption.

2. Preparing the Injection Site

Disinfect the injection site with an alcohol swab and allow it to dry completely. Do not touch the cleaned area afterward.

3. Performing the Injection

Hold the syringe at a 45 to 90-degree angle, depending on the thickness of the subcutaneous tissue. Insert the needle fully into the tissue, then slowly push the plunger to inject the medication. Withdrawal the needle quickly and apply gentle pressure with a new alcohol swab, if necessary.

4. Disposal of Used Materials

Immediately dispose of needles and syringes into a designated sharps container. Do not recap needles to prevent injury.
